We made most of our way back to Utah today, but this time via the “southern” route (i.e. I-70 as far as was reasonable).

I regret that it wasn’t possible to make photographs while driving Glenwood Canyon in Colorado. That part will live on only in my memory.

Once we turned off the freeway and onto smaller roads, I could make some photos again. Most of these are in the northwest corner of Colorado:

We spent the night in Vernal, Utah, a few hours east of Salt Lake City, and the supposed gateway to dinosaur land.
